What Are Wool Berber Rugs?
Wool Berber rugs are traditional handmade pieces crafted by Berber tribes, originally from North Africa, particularly Morocco. These rugs are characterized by their thick, plush texture and intricate geometric patterns. They are typically made from natural wool, which provides warmth, durability, and a soft feel underfoot. These rugs have been an integral part of Berber culture for centuries, with each piece often reflecting the unique story and history of the maker. The use of wool in Berber rugs ensures longevity and resilience, making them a popular choice for homes looking for both style and substance.
Unique Features of Wool Berber Rugs
What sets wool berber rugs apart from other types of area rugs is their distinct appearance and construction. Unlike flat-weave rugs, Berber rugs have a more textured surface, with knots that create a bumpy, 3D effect. This texture not only adds visual interest but also enhances the rug’s functionality. The designs are often minimalist, featuring neutral tones such as ivory, beige, and brown, though some may include colorful accents. The geometric patterns are symbolic, with each design holding cultural significance, often inspired by nature or spiritual beliefs. This uniqueness makes wool Berber rugs an attractive addition to any interior decor.
Durability and Maintenance of Wool Berber Rugs
One of the key advantages of wool Berber rugs is their incredible durability. Wool fibers are naturally resilient, resisting wear and tear while maintaining their appearance over time. These rugs are excellent for high-traffic areas, as the wool helps to preserve the shape and integrity of the rug even with constant use. Maintenance is also relatively easy. Regular vacuuming will remove dirt and debris, while occasional deep cleaning with a professional service ensures the rug’s longevity. Moreover, wool naturally resists stains and repels moisture, making these rugs a practical choice for homes with children or pets.
